Summary:The increasing demand for skilled and well-balanced personnel due to the advent of K-economy and globalization has led the Ministry of Higher Education (MOHE) to develop a higher education environment that supports the growth of continuing education in Malaysia. UTMSPACE, since its inception in 1994, has expanded its role in providing English language training through the establishment of the English Language and Preparatory Programme Unit (UBIPP) in 2007. There are demands for English short courses and tailor-made programmes such as English Communication Skills at the Workplace, Oral Presentation Skills and Technical Writing Workshop from the private and public sectors. This paper focuses on the need for retraining of English language competency in continuing education for employees at the workplace. Feedback from training providers, industrial and government sectors are crucial in determining the type of language training needed. The outcome of this paper may provide some insights for future improvement and development in providing lifelong learning to enhance strategic alliances with local and foreign higher educational institutions in the field of training development and continuing education.
